Fished in the stained areas of Theodosia arm.  WT was 53-58, air temps were nice most of Sat but chilly and windy on Sunday.  Tried to fish shallow, but nothing happening there for me but a few nibbles from gills.  Moved deeper and started doing better.  Caught a good bunch of LMB and spots, as well as some gills and crappie for good measure.  Also caught one nice 4.5# walleye when bank fishing.  Definitely had some fish full of eggs, so hopefully a good spawn coming this year.  Most fish were on minnow style baits and stick baits.
